Blurry QR Codes Do Not Scan — Here Is How to Fix Them

QR code readers detect the three finder patterns (the large squares in the corners) and alignment patterns to decode data. When a QR code is blurry, low-resolution, or has poor contrast, the scanner cannot distinguish black modules from the white background. The result is a failed scan or incorrect data.

Why QR Codes Become Unscannable

Several common issues prevent QR codes from scanning reliably:

  • Low-resolution source images: QR codes saved at small pixel dimensions lack enough detail for scanners to read accurately.
  • Blurry or compressed images: JPEG compression, motion blur, or out-of-focus photos smear the module boundaries.
  • Faded or colored QR codes: Gray, light, or colored modules reduce contrast against the background, making detection unreliable.
  • Missing quiet zones: The white border around a QR code (the "quiet zone") is required for scanning. If it is cropped or obscured, scanners fail.
  • Printing degradation: Ink bleed, low-quality printers, and worn materials degrade QR code scannability over time.

The enhancer applies a three-step pipeline to restore scannability:

1. Force Black & White Contrast

The enhancer analyzes every pixel in the QR code image and converts it to either pure black or pure white — no gray, no colors, no gradients. This is the most effective way to fix QR codes affected by fading, coloring, or low contrast.

QR code scanners are designed to read binary patterns — black modules on a white background. Any deviation from this (gray pixels, colored modules, gradient backgrounds) reduces scanning reliability. Forcing pure B&W ensures maximum contrast and maximum scan reliability.

2. Repair Quiet Zones

The quiet zone is the white border that surrounds a QR code. Per the QR code specification, the quiet zone must be at least 4 module widths wide. Without it, scanners cannot distinguish the QR code from surrounding content.

The enhancer automatically detects whether the quiet zone is missing or insufficient and restores it. This is critical for QR codes that have been cropped from screenshots, cut from printed materials, or embedded in documents without proper spacing.

Fix Printed QR Codes That Became Blurry

Printed materials degrade over time. Flyers get smudged, business cards get worn, and posters fade in sunlight. The enhancer restores these codes to scannable quality by forcing B&W contrast and upscaling to 4K resolution.

Enhance QR Codes from Screenshots

Screenshots are often low-resolution or compressed, especially when shared through messaging apps or social media. The enhancer increases QR code resolution so that even heavily compressed screenshots become scannable again.

Upscale Low-Res QR Codes for Print

Need to print a QR code at a large size but only have a small source image? Upscaling to 4K ensures the QR code has enough pixels to print crisply at any size — posters, banners, or packaging.

Fix Faded QR Codes on Old Materials

Old documents, worn labels, and sun-bleached signs produce faded QR codes with poor contrast. The B&W contrast forcing feature converts gray, faded modules back to pure black, making the code scannable again.
